Job Title: Senior Test Engineer
Job Description: Senior Test Engineer - Unified Communications (Shanghai)
Interface with development, marketing, customers, and partners to understand product deployment scenarios and use cases and translate them into testable requirements
Work closely with development and customer support teams in recreation and resolution of customer reported problems
Research the test tool solution based on the project requirement
Testing tool design and implementation
Design and code review with developer
Responsible for test bed and environment setup for feature, system, regression testing and problem recreation
Participate in test escape analysis and refine test process
Strive for continuous improvements in testing methodologies and productivity
5 - 10 years of relevant work experience
MS/BS in Computer science, Information Science, Telecommunication, Engineering or related fields
Must-Have Skill / Experience
Strong network background, expertise in TCP/IP
Strong VOIP knowledge, Expertise in VOIP protocols like SIP/H.323
Good English communication skills (in written and verbal)
Strong analytical and problem solving skills
Ability to learn new technology quickly and willing to take any challenge
Nice-to-Have Skills / Experience
CCNP, CCIE certification
Familiar with Cisco voice and routing/switching products
Good knowledge in Linux OS
C/C++ or Java programming experience and debug skills
职位二：上海-Cisco C/C++&Jabber XMPP developers.
* Strong XMPP and IM development experience.
* Familiar with related RFCs
* 5+ years of software development experience with C/C++ programming
* Experience with Linux, multi threading, state machines
* Strong analytical and communication skills
* Ability to work independently and as part of a team
* Mobile development experience is a plus
* Develop IM module for enterprise unified collaboration apps (IM, voice, video, etc) that run on various platforms (Windows, Mac, iOS, Android)
职位三：上海-Cisco-Senior Embedded Software Engineer - Protocol
Powered by the Cisco QuantumFlow Processor(QFP), the industry's first scalable and programmable application aware network processor, the Cisco ASR 1000 Series is the industry's first highly scalable WAN and Internet edge router platform that delivers embedded hardware acceleration for Cisco IOS Software services. ASR 1000 Series is a critical part of the Cisco Borderless Network Architecture, redefines WAN services by delivering superior system performance,high availability and integrated services. http://www.cisco.com/en/US/products/ps9343/index.html
Senior Software Development Engineer:
- Design and develop Cisco ASR1000's platform forwarding infra and QFP forwarding features including IPV4/IPV6 forwarding, Virtual fragmentation Reassembly, IP tunnels, MPLS infra & L2/L3VPN, policy or performance based routing features, Deep Packet Inspect(DPI) features etc.
- Develop Next Generation router platforms using IOS-XE.
- Support customer deployment.
.Strong C/C++ programming experience on Linux/Unix/Vxworks. Development experience on embedded system is preferred.
.Good knowledge of operation systems such as Linux, Unix or Vxworks.
.Working experience on TCP/IP network and protocols. Working experience on OSPF, BGP, MPLS etc. is preferred.
.Knowledge of network protocols and solutions is a plus such as IPv6 solutions (6RD/ISATAP, 6PE/6VPE, NAT64), MPLS/MPLS-TE, Multicast, QoS, MPLS VPN, L2VPN, IPSec VPN, TLS/SSL, Firewall, NAT, Broadband etc.
.Experience on Cisco IOS and Cisco certifications will be a plus.
.Good English and Chinese communication skills (both written and verbal)
职位四：上海-Cisco-Cloud Computing Software engineer-Networking
Cisco, is the worldwide leader in networking that transforms how people connect, communicate and collaborate. Today, networks are an essential part of business, education, government and home communications, and Cisco's Internet Protocol-based (IP) networking solutions are the foundation of these networks.
We are seeking software engineers to develop clouding infrastructure and application on Cisco ASR 1000 platforms, the leading middle range routing platforms with advanced services. ASR1000 is shipped product and experiencing great revenue growth. You will define, design, build and sustain platform software components along with designing and building platform software infrastructure for our next generation routers. You will work in number of different OS environments including developing on programmable network processing engines.
The ideal candidate will have:
- Excellent design, programming and debugging skills (C/C++).
- Embedded systems development experience (e.g. IOS, VxWorks, Linux, etc.).
- Protocol-related development experience (e.g. QOS, IP, UDP, ATM, Frame, SNMP, PNNI, MPLS, etc.).
- Well versed in UNIX/Linux development environment and software development life cycle.
- Knowledge of operating systems architecture including semaphores, task switching, IPC, pre-emptive scheduling, and memory management. Linux kernel experience a definite plus.
- Troubleshooting issues and customer support experience.
- Good communication/influence skill and ability to lead/mentor/coach other team members.
- Demonstrable experience in driving large feature or SW development project from requirements development through test and deployment.
- Experience of working on high-end router platforms, XMPP knowledge is a plus.